[1] Input impedance: Refer to Table A on page 8.
[2] Crest factor ≤ 3.0 at full scale, 5.0 at half scale except the 1000 mV and 1000 V ranges where it is 1.5 at full scale, 3.0 at half scale.
[3] The additional error to be added as frequency >20 kHz and signal input <10% of range: 3 counts of LSD per kHz.
[4] The input signal is lower than 20,000,000 V-Hz (the product of voltage and frequency).
[5] Input current >35 µArms.
[6] Current can be measured from 2.5 A up to 10 A continuously. An additional 0.5% needs to be added to the specifi ed accuracy if the signal measured is in the range of 10 A ~ 20 A for 30
[7] Input current < 3 Arms.
[8] For non-square wave signals, add 5 counts.
[9] AC voltage and AC current specifi cations are true RMS AC coupled, valid from 5% to 100% of range.
